Examining age-specific trends in the incidence of anorectal cancer associated with human papillomavirus in the United States.
Abstract
e15690 Background: The incidence of anorectal cancer has increased in the United States. We estimated the potential impact of HPV vaccination on anorectal cancer rates in younger populations. Methods: Data were extracted from the United States Cancer Statistics Public Use Database (USCS), HPV vaccination rates were from the Behavioral Risk Factor Surveillance System (BRFSS), and data on sexual behavior were obtained from National Health and Nutrition Examination Survey (NHANES). Statistical analyses were conducted using the Joinpoint Regression Program (National Cancer Institute) and Pearson correlation coefficients. Results: Based on USCS data, anorectal cancer incidence rates are over 2-fold higher in women compared to men (3.43 vs. 1.57/100,000) in the year 2021. Over the 20 years study period, there has been an average increase of 3.96% per year in women and (p < 0.001) 2.77% annually in men (p = 0.002). After the HPV vaccine's approval for young females in 2006 and young males in 2009, we compared younger versus older individuals lacking access to assess the vaccine's impact on anorectal cancer incidence. Although there is an overall increase in anorectal cancers, the younger cohort 35-39 and 40-44 age groups showed a 1.51% (p = 0.109) and 1.81% (p < 0.001) decrease in incidence from 2001 to 2021. In contrast, the older cohort without access to vaccination, 60-64 and 65-69 years old, observed a 3.72% (p < 0.001) and 3.78% (p < 0.001) increase during this same period, respectively. Using the BRFSS from 2008 to 2021, the rate of HPV vaccination was over 3-fold higher in the younger (19-44 years old) vs. older (45-49 years old) cohort (22.0% vs. 6.92%). Furthermore, data on exposure to HPV vaccination from 2010-2021 showed a negative correlation with anorectal cancer incidence in men (R = -0.749, p-value < 0.005) and women (R = -0.118, p-value = 0.716). Based on gender, among those 35-39 years old, anorectal cancer incidence declined by 2.25% (p = 0.026) in men, with no change in women (AAPC: -0.86, p = 0.170). To analyze the differences in anal sex practices by demographic, we also utilized the NHANES database from 2005-2016 and showed that the proportion of men who have ever practiced anal sex was higher than women (41.2% vs. 37.2% p < 0.001). Conclusions: Compared to men, women have a two-fold higher incidence of anorectal cancer and continues to rise annually possibly due to differences in sexual behaviors. However, in the younger cohort, a significant decrease was observed, possibly associated with HPV vaccination.
